Abstract
The differences in resident backgrounds are a challenge for counselors and social workers who working in the rehabilitation of drug abuse. Residents with different backgrounds have different potentials. The potential difference is due to the uneven level of education in society, especially in the lower-middle class. Counselors and social workers must be able to explore and develop the potential of each resident so that after they finish from rehabilitation, they can survive in the community and society will no longer consider them as trash. This can be realized by giving full attention by the counselor to the resident during the rehabilitation process
